RIM has something for everyone
A wide variety of activities
are available to all students
spring term through the
Recreation and Intramurai
office. Among the 19
structured programs planned
are four new spring events: a
golf scramble tournament,
indoor soccer league, four
on-four basketball and flag
football have been added to
the list of spring activities.
Among old events, soft ban
is in full swing with about
150 teams participating at
various levels, as is a single
elimination team tennis
tournament.
A complete schedule of
activities is listed below.
Those preceded by an “x”
are intramural sports.
Divisions are coded as
follows: M-men, W-women,
C-coed.
